Paul Giamatti is an American character actor and producer. He is most well-known for his parts in a variety of films, including “Private Parts,” “Sideways,” and “Rock of Ages,” among others. Paul is the youngest of three children who were born to his parents and was born in the state of Connecticut. He began schooling at Foote School and continued at Choate Rosemary Hall until he received his diploma. After that, he received his Master of Fine Arts degree from Yale University, where he had previously studied.

The Howard Stern biography “Private Parts” marked the beginning of his career in Hollywood. He had minor roles in high-profile films such as “The Truman Show,” “Saving Private Ryan,” and “The Negotiator.” His parts were well received. Giamatti’s performance in ‘Sideways’ earned him his first nomination for a Golden Globe, and ‘Cinderella Man’ earned him his first nomination for an Academy Award.

Paul has worked as a voice artist in addition to his acting and producing careers. His voice has been included in several movies, including “Robots,” “Asterix and the Vikings,” “The Ant Bully,” and a great deal more. Samuel Giamatti is the product of his marriage to Elizabeth Cohen; they have a son together. Brooklyn, New York, is where the family has made their home. Paul Giamatti entered the world on June 6, 1967, in New Haven, Connecticut. His father’s name is A.

Toni Marilyn Giamatti was a housewife and an English teacher, while her son Bartlett Giamatti was a professor at Yale University. Bartlett Giamatti was named after his mother. The family has three children, and Paul is the youngest. He began his academic career at the Foote School and got his degree in 1985 from Choate Rosemary Hall. In 1989, Paul graduated from the Yale School of Drama with a Master of Fine Arts degree after obtaining his Bachelor of Arts degree in English.

He began his career in acting in the theatre and has since been in various theatrical shows, including those on Broadway. He gave performances at the Annex Theatre in Seattle from 1989 through 1992. In the early 1990s, Paul Giamatti had a few supporting parts in various television and film productions. In the movies ‘Past Midnight’ (1991), ‘Singles’ (1992), ‘Mighty Aphrodite’ (1995), and ‘Sabrina’ (1995), as well as ‘Donnie Brasco’ (1997), he played supporting characters.

In 1997, the film “Private Parts,” a biography of Howard Stern, provided him with his first significant break. His work in the movie received a lot of praise, so he was nominated for an Academy Award in the category of Best Supporting Actor. He appeared in minor roles in several high-profile productions, including “My Best Friend’s Wedding” (1997), “The Truman Show” (1998), “Saving Private Ryan” (1998), and “The Negotiator” (1998). In addition, he has roles in the films “Safe Men” (1998) and “Cradle Will Rock” (1999).


In 1999, the biopic “Man on the Moon” about Andy Kaufman had Paul Giamatti in one of the lead roles. His work in ‘Big Momma’s House’ earned him a nomination for the Blockbuster Entertainment Award in the category of Favourite Supporting Actor – Comedy in 2000. This was his first nomination. After that, he resumed his acting career in commercial films such as “Duets” (2000), “Storytelling” (2001), “Planet of the Apes” (2001), and “Big Fat Liar” (2002). In addition, he played in Pete Hewitt’s film “Thunderpants,” released in 2002.

In 2003, Hel’s performance in the film ‘American Splendour’ was met with widespread praise from the film’s reviewers. The same year, he also played in the movies “Paycheck” and “Confidence.”In the film ‘Sideways’, which came out in 2004, he played one of the most important roles of his career. As a result of his performance, he was nominated for several prizes and nominations, including the Golden Globe, which was the first time it had happened. In 2005, he was recognized for his portrayal in the film “Cinderella Man,” which earned him a nomination for another Golden Globe and several other accolades.

Both ‘Robots’ (2005) and ‘Asterix and the Vikings’ (2006) included him as a voice actor, and both films were released in 2005 and 2006.
In the film “Lady in the Water,” released in 2006, Paul Giamatti portrayed the major character. Giamatti has also appeared in “The Hawk Is Dying” and “The Illusionist.” In the 2006 animated movie “The Ant Bully,” he provided his voice acting services. In 2007, he was seen in several films, including “The Nanny Diaries,” “Fred Claus,” and “Shoot ‘Em Up,” all of which were set in the same year. His performance in “Shoot ‘Em Up” was particularly noteworthy.

In 2007, he provided his vocals for the song “Too Loud a Solitude.In 2008, he was honored with his first Golden Globe Award for his role in the television miniseries titled “John Adams.” In 2008, he starred in and produced the film ‘Pretty Bird’. In 2009, he also appeared in the movie “Duplicity” and “Cold Souls.”In 2009, he appeared as an actor in “The Last Station” and “The Haunted World of El Superbeasto,” for which he provided his voice. In 2010, he was honored with the Golden Globe Award for Best Actor for his work in the film “Barney’s Version.” This was his second time winning the award.

In 2011, he starred as the main character in the highly praised film ‘Win Win’. In 2011, he also appeared in the films “Ironclad,” “The Hangover Part II,” and “The Ides of March” in supporting or cameo capacities. His work in the television movie ‘Too Big to Fail’ in 2011 received much positive feedback from viewers. In 2012, Paul Giamatti had roles in the films “Rock of Ages” and “Cosmopolis,” in addition to acting in and producing “John Dies at the End.” In 2013, he lent his voice to the animated film “Turbo” and appeared in the films “The Congress,” “Romeo & Juliet,” and “Parkland.”

His work in the 2013 film ’12 Years a Slave’ received much positive reviewer feedback. In 2013, he starred in “Saving Mr. Banks” and “All Is Bright,” both of which he performed in and produced. Paul had a guest appearance in an episode of “Downton Abbey” in 2013, and that performance earned him a nomination for an Emmy Award.2014 was the year that he made appearances in “River of Fundament,” “The Amazing Spider-Man 2,” and “Madame Bovary.”

He provided his voice for the animated films ‘Ernest & Celestine’ (2014), ‘Giant Sloth’ (2014), and ‘The Little Prince’ (2015). During the 2014-2015 television season, he appeared in a handful of episodes of the comedy series “Inside Any Schumer,” for which he earned a nomination for an Emmy Award. In 2015, he appeared in the highly acclaimed films ‘San Andreas’ and ‘Straight Outta Compton’. In 2016, he provided his voice for the video games “Ratchet & Clank” and “April and the Extraordinary World.”

In 2016, he appeared in “The Phenom” and “Morgan.” In 2017, he also appeared in “The Catcher Was a Spy.”The roles that made Paul Giamatti famous include those in the films ‘American Splendour’ (2003), ‘Sideways’ (2004), and ‘Cinderella Man’ (2005), as well as the television series ‘John Adams (2008) and ‘Barney’s Version’ (2010). As a result of these performances, he was recognized with several accolades and nominations. His performance in the miniseries ‘Too Big to Fail'(2011), the film ’12 Years a Slave (2013), and the television series ‘Inside Amy Schumer’ (2014-2015) is also rather well recognized.

The performances garnered him a lot of accolades from critics. In 2003, the National Board of Review honored Paul Giamatti for his performance in ‘American Splendour’ by presenting him with their award for Best Breakthrough Performance. In addition to his nominations for ‘Sideways’ (2004) and ‘Cinderella Man’ (2005) for the Golden Globe Award, he received the Boston Society of Film Critics Award, the Screen Actors Guild Award, and several other awards. In 2008, he won his first Golden Globe Award for his work on the film “John Adams.”

In 2010, Paul Giamatti received his second Golden Globe Award for his work on the film “Barney’s Version.”He was nominated for a Primetime Emmy Award for the shows ‘Too Big to Fall’ (2011), ‘Downton Abbey (2013), and ‘Inside Amy Schumer’ (2014-15). Elizabeth Cohen and Paul Giamatti have been married since the year 1997. Samuel Giamatti, born in 2001, is the child of the marriage. Brooklyn, New York, is the place the family calls home.
